Introduction

DevOps is an approach to software development that focuses on improving collaboration between teams of developers, quality assurance (QA), and operations. By utilizing DevOps solutions, organizations can reduce the time to market for new features and products, improve collaboration between teams, decrease the risk in production environments, respond faster to customer complaints or requests, and decrease costs associated with debugging and fixing errors.

Strategies To Improve Performance And Efficiency With DevOps

DevOps has become a popular strategy for enhancing performance and efficiency in the workplace. It involves utilizing modern tools, automation, and collaboration to create dependable systems with early detection and swift corrections. When executed correctly, DevOps can assist businesses in boost incrementally in performance, scalability, customer support, and cost-efficiency. Below are some strategies that can aid businesses in enhancing their performance with DevOps.

To begin, it is essential to comprehend the benefits of DevOps in order to develop a successful implementation strategy. Afterwards, it is recommended to automate routine processes to speed up problem resolution and optimize for the utmost performance and scalability. Additionally, modern tools such as chatbots or communication platforms can be utilized to streamline processes, fostering collaboration between teams.

Integrating machine learning and predictive analytics into the workflow is another crucial step. This will enable teams to quickly spot any errors or issues that may occur and understand customers’ feedback so that customer service can be improved upon. Automation must also be employed throughout the process to ensure maximum efficiency. For instance, automating deployments or testing tasks such as regression tests or static code analysis tests can lead to faster development cycles without compromising quality assurance objectives.
